Business Intelligence courses can help you learn data analysis, reporting techniques, data visualization, and predictive analytics. You can build skills in interpreting complex datasets, making data-driven decisions, and communicating insights effectively. Many courses introduce tools like Tableau, Power BI, and SQL, that support transforming raw data into actionable strategies and visual representations that inform business decisions.
